Jordan Foster
Address: ** ******* *****, ******* ****, IL 62040, USA
Phone: +1-618-***-****
Email: **************@*****.***
PROFESSIONAL SUMMARY
Highly motivated and organized software engineer with a proven background in delivering successful projects. Experienced in all aspects of the development life cycle including creating wireframes and mockups, architecture planning, building, and testing products, and deploying them in production environments.
TECHNICAL SKILLS
Programming: JavaScript, Git, NPM, TypeScript, React, Yarn, Lerna, Node.js, SQL, C#, Laravel, PostgreSQL, ASP.Net, MVC, Webforms, REST API, HTML, CSS, SCSS, AWS, JQuery, PHP, Webpack, Rollup, Azure, Angular, Java, Material-UI, Tailwind, Redis, Storybook, Selenium
CMS / E-Commerce: WordPress, Shopify, Umbraco, Ecwid, WooCommerce, Salesforce Commerce Cloud (SFCC)
SEO: Yoast, All-in-One SEO, SEMrush
Miscellaneous: Facebook Ads Manager, Salesforce, Adobe XD, Figma, Photoshop
EXPERIENCE
NEW BALANCE — SOFTWARE ENGINEER
SEP 2023 - PRESENT
●Collaborated with three cross-functional teams of 7-10 engineers to design, develop, and enhance multiple facets across twelve New Balance websites.
●Developed and implemented JavaScript components and features within the Salesforce Commerce Cloud environment, enhancing site functionality and user experience.
●Authored comprehensive unit tests for a variety of elements including functions, components, services, API endpoints, and controllers, ensuring robustness and reliability.
●Analyzed user stories to research and evaluate potential solutions, contributing significantly to the scrum workflow and project deliverables of the team.
●Initiated and successfully integrated two innovative ideas across the company, leading to significant improvements in the codebase and website functionality.
●Implemented integration of the “Stylitics” AI customer recommendation engine into the New Balance website, personalizing shopping experiences by suggesting complete outfits based on user browsing behavior.
DSM / MARKETING MILK — SOFTWARE ENGINEER
OCT 2019 - JAN 2023
●Built the UI/UX for our in-house Facebook ad building and reporting SaaS platform using React.js and TypeScript.
●Built a simplified demographics picker by integrating with multiple Facebook APIs, flattening a recursive data structure, and exposing results to the front end via REST API.
●Built and tested dozens of UI components and maintained a private NPM frontend library of components, hooks, and services used across multiple frontend applications.
●Contributed to the implementation of a role and permission system using Auth0.
●Streamlined our complex array of libraries and applications by consolidating them within a mono repository using Lerna.
●Scrum methodologies for agile software development - GraphQL and REST APIs for seamless data exchange
●Redux.js/Context for state management in frontend applications - AWS and Docker for cloud-based deployment
●Conducted interviews and created frontend guidelines and interview processes
●Lead and managed several special projects working directly with the CEO
●Experience building custom React hooks
●SQL and PostgreSQL for efficient data management
●Front-end Development with React.js, TypeScript, Tailwind, and Material-UI
●Microservices architecture to ensure scalability
●Testing frameworks such as Jest, React Testing Library, and Cypress
●Webpack and Lerna for streamlined development and sharing of code
●Proficiency in Node.js, TypeORM, and NestJS for robust backend development
●Implemented Redis for caching frequently requested data
●Git for version control and collaborative development
●Expertise in creating mockups with Figma/AdobeXD (designed 70% of platform UI)
●Strong JavaScript proficiency with a focus on clean and maintainable code
●Worked on AWS lambda functions, EC2 instances, cloudwatch, etc.
●Maintained legacy PHP/laravel backend system used for email notifications to users
●Setup CI/CD pipelines in GitLab for staging, beta, and production environments
●Built a scavenger hunt app used in a marketing campaign for the St. Louis Blues, Anheuser-Busch, and the NHL All-Star Game. Worked directly with the Marketing Directors of both organizations to ensure the product met the needs of their campaign.
DRIVE SOCIAL MEDIA (DSM) — WEB DEVELOPER
MAR 2019 - OCT 2019
●Resolved extensive backlog of client web work
●Maintained +60 client websites, optimizing SEO, and page speeds using various plugins and tools like SEM Rush.
●Developed three core websites for the company using WordPress: joshsample.com, drivesocialnow.com, and marketingmilk.com (although I am no longer responsible for their maintenance).
●Established efficient processes and workflows to ensure the ongoing success of the team.
●Proficient in WordPress website management and optimization
●Advanced knowledge of PHP, HTML, and SCSS for custom website development
●Expertise in image optimization and content-focused SEO techniques
●Thorough understanding of website performance optimization
●Responsive web design implementation across multiple devices
●Collaborative approach to working with cross-functional teams
●Strong attention to detail and commitment to delivering top-tier websites
●Ability to transform mockups into functional and visually appealing web assets
AVALA MARKETING GROUP — EMAIL PRODUCT MANAGER
APR 2018 - MAR 2019
●Built +600 dynamic marketing emails using customer data for personalization and higher conversion rates.
●Managed the email platform of our internal SaaS product ensuring user UI/UX was ideal and system stress testing.
●Developed a program to check for previously flagged spam emails/IPs and correct common misspellings to help improve email list health and sender reputation.
●Executed and monitored large-scale email marketing campaigns, targeting lists with recipient counts ranging from 100,000 to 1 million.
●Worked with Mailgun API’s using Postman and Insomnia
●Mentored and trained a team of junior developers
●Worked directly with clients and users to assess features, needs, and goals for product development
AVALA MARKETING GROUP — WEB DEVELOPER
JAN 2018 - APR 2018
●Proficient in .NET, MVC, Angular, and the Umbraco CMS, contributing to the development of enterprise-grade websites.
●Diligently addressed and resolved visual bugs to optimize user experience and website performance.
●Maintained and updated REST APIs connected to Aimbase, our in-house SAAS product, for personalized customer experiences.
●Managed content updates on client websites, ensuring relevancy and real-time updates to reflect their evolving business needs.
●Conducted minor database updates to effectively showcase new products and updated product information
●Developed several client sites in React.js
AVALA MARKETING GROUP — Junior Software Engineer
MAR 2017 - JAN 2018
●Performed SQL database changes involving extensive SQL queries for account executives and senior developers
●Built HTML client marketing emails for mass marketing campaigns
●Supported web team by making updates to client websites built in Angular and Umbraco
●Made small changes to our SaaS product, Aimbase, built in C#, ASP.Net, MVC, Azure, etc.
Foster Media, LLC. — Owner
JAN 2016 - Present
Foster Media is a side business I’ve owned over the years under which I’ve helped clients with basic I.T. needs, and/or consulted on more complicated issues. Examples being:
●Designed and developed responsive and visually appealing websites for clients, enhancing their online SEO presence and user experience.
●Utilized HTML, CSS, JavaScript, and various content management systems (listed above) to create custom and dynamic web solutions.
●Conducted regular consultations to assess ongoing requirements and provided proactive recommendations for continuous improvement.
●Led end-to-end project management for various initiatives, ensuring timely delivery, budget adherence, and high quality output.
●Stayed on top of industry trends and new technologies to create new solutions for client projects.
●Introduced automation technologies and optimization strategies, resulting in increased operational and user efficiency and cost savings.
●Developed and implemented marketing strategies like social media, a professional website, and targeted Facebook or Google marketing campaigns, resulting in increased visibility and a growing client base.
EDUCATION
RANKEN UNIVERSITY
Bachelor’s Degree in Internet Web-Based Technology
2012 - 2016
(3.9 GPA)
●Transferred PSD designs to HTML and CSS markup
●Studied Java and object oriented programming
●Studied C#, ASP.Net, MVC, SQL, and Azure
●Designed and built a help desk application for college using C# and Asp.Net web forms that’s still being used today